How are you after the Christmas break? This is a time of family-closeness that so many of the children find difficult. If you survived in tact, then expect some fall-out in the next week or two. Anticipating fall-out often helps it not to be so devastating. Good times are hard for children who don't trust 'love'. Their belief is either 'I don't deserve anything good' or 'I don't need anyone - I only trust myself'. If you get shouted at and told what a rotten parent you are, hear it as 'this has been hard for me and I am worried that my world is going to fall in like it has done in the past'. If that is what they said, how would you respond?
